About The Pentecostal Assemblies of Canada (PAOC)

The PAOC is a Fellowship of more than 1,100 churches across English- and French-speaking Canada. More than 235,000 people across the nation attend services in more than 40 languages, and they are pleased to provide ministerial credentials for more than 3,500 pastors and ministry leaders. They also help facilitate the vital work of spreading the good news of the gospel of our Lord Jesus Christ and bringing hope and help to those in need in Canada and around the world.

About the Senior Financial Analyst Role

The Senior Financial Analyst is responsible for financial reporting, analysis, budgeting, compliance, and systems improvement in alignment with CRA regulations for registered charities. This role requires a blend of technical expertise, analytical insight, and adaptability to support informed decision-making and maintain the organization’s financial health.

Specifically, in this role you’d be responsible for:

  • Preparing mon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ements and reports, including T3010 filings.
  • Conducting variance analysis and providing actionable insights for strategic decision-making.
  • Developing and maintaining dashboards and reports using tools like Power BI.
  • Supporting the preparation of audit working papers and liaising with external auditors.
  • Supporting the annual budgeting process and monitoring actuals vs. budget.
  • Reviewing and posting journal entries, accruals, and reconciliations.
  • Ensuring compliance with Canadian accounting standards for not-for-profits (ASNPO) and CRA charity regulations.
  • Leveraging ERP systems (e.g., Business Central) to streamline processes and improve reporting accuracy.
  • Assisting in risk assessments and internal audits.
  • Training and supporting staff in financial systems and reporting tools.
